
Hyundai Motor Co., South Korea's top automaker, will begin selling a revamped Genesis luxury sedan in China this month, a company official said Saturday, as it seeks to better compete with German brands in the high-end segment of the world's largest car market.
The revamped Genesis, which was introduced in South Korea in November and in the United States in April, will hit showrooms in China on Aug. 18, the official said on the condition of anonymity because he was not authorized to speak to the media.
The premium sedan is expected to directly compete with BMW's 5-Series, Daimler AG's Mercedes-Benz E-Class and Volkswagen AG's Audi in China.
